Output 84c54d27ae76f581db5223eda164e5b8c2aeddb665f00dff294b20eecbb04ec4:0

value
146086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a8333649d74344a410c6816fd3384bd7aa75df OP_EQUAL
address
MEhujNQFFKdmXbXA5LNw71kqJBXcLQn66f
transaction
84c54d27ae76f581db5223eda164e5b8c2aeddb665f00dff294b20eecbb04ec4
spent
true